Alternative therapies for sinusitis and rhinitis: a systematic review utilizing a modified Delphi method.

Arthur W Wu1, John D Gettelfinger2, Jonathan Y Ting2

  • 1Division of Otolaryngology-Head and Neck Surgery, Cedars-Sinai Medical Center, Los Angeles, CA.

International Forum of Allergy & Rhinology
|February 28, 2020
PubMed
Summary

This study evaluated alternative therapies for sinusitis and rhinitis, finding limited evidence for most. Acupuncture, capsaicin, bromelain, and butterbur showed some promise, but comparisons to conventional treatments are scarce.

Area of Science:

  • Otolaryngology
  • Integrative Medicine
  • Evidence-Based Medicine

Background:

  • Sinusitis and rhinitis are prevalent conditions driving significant patient healthcare utilization.
  • The alternative therapy market is substantial, yet scientific validation of efficacy and safety remains limited.
  • This research aimed to systematically identify and evaluate evidence supporting alternative treatments for these common respiratory conditions.

Purpose of the Study:

  • To identify and grade the scientific evidence for alternative therapies used in treating sinusitis and rhinitis.
  • To assess the efficacy, potential harms, and future research directions for these complementary treatments.
  • To provide an expert consensus on the current state of evidence for alternative sinusitis and rhinitis therapies.

Main Methods:

  • A modified Delphi method engaged rhinology experts to establish consensus on evidence, harm, and research needs.
  • Systematic literature searches were conducted using PubMed, EMBASE, and Cochrane databases.
  • Evidence levels and recommendations were assessed using Centre for Evidence-Based Medicine (CEBM) and Grading of Recommendations, Assessment, Development and Evaluations (GRADE) criteria.

Main Results:

  • Over 60 alternative therapies were identified; 220 full-text articles were reviewed.
  • Most therapies demonstrated minimal to no scientific evidence of effectiveness.
  • Acupuncture, capsaicin, bromelain, and butterbur extract received low to moderate-high GRADE ratings, particularly for allergic rhinitis.

Conclusions:

  • Certain alternative therapies, including acupuncture and specific botanical extracts, show potential benefits, primarily in placebo-controlled trials.
  • Robust comparative studies against conventional medical treatments for sinusitis and rhinitis are largely absent.
  • Unsubstantiated claims and overlooked side effects on numerous alternative therapy websites necessitate careful patient counseling and further rigorous research.
